Defining Clarity in a Complex Ecosystem

When AI Sounds Powerful But Feels Abstract
369AI had a bold ambition: AI agents operating directly inside NetSuite to eliminate manual effort, reduce operational friction, and increase visibility across teams. The challenge wasn’t the technology. It was positioning. AI inside ERP systems can easily feel abstract and overly technical. The audience: CFOs, CIOs, and IT leaders doesn’t respond to hype. They respond to clarity, control, and measurable outcomes. The existing structure felt feature heavy and complex. What was missing was a clear narrative that translated AI into operational impact. This wasn’t about redesigning a website. It was about defining a category.



A Scalable SaaS Platform Built for Authority
Midway through development, it became clear the platform needed more flexibility than the original setup allowed. The decision was made to rebuild in Webflow. Creating a modular structure designed for scale. The new architecture was built around outcomes, not features: – Clear, benefit-driven hero positioning – An “Intent → Action” framework to explain how AI operates inside NetSuite – Industry-based solution segmentation – AI Agents presented as tangible digital team members – A scalable system allowing new agents and industries to be added without rebuilding the site The result is a SaaS platform that feels structured, credible, and expandable. 369AI is no longer positioned as an abstract AI tool. It now communicates authority inside the NetSuite ecosystem with a digital foundation built for long term growth.
